About the role

The Conversion Crew Team Lead serves as a Conversion Crew team member while overseeing the team during their assigned shifts. They are responsible for setup and breakdown of various furnishings and equipment for events and theatre productions.

Responsibilities

  • Read floorplan diagrams and execute written instructions for setups and breakdowns of in-house and rented equipment including tables, chairs, dance floors, staging platforms, trashcans, portable bars, coat racks, stanchions, and other non-technical equipment.
  • Review instructions with and delegate tasks to conversion crew members assigned to each shift.
  • Ensure team members are working efficiently and redirect work as needed.
  • Perform all aspects of setup and breakdown, including connecting and laying out dance floor, rolling and lifting tables, moving and setting stage platforms, stacking and unstacking chairs, setting stanchions for crowd management, moving equipment in and out of storage areas, and more.
  • Understand and enforce all safety guidelines and best practices for inspecting and handling materials and equipment, proper techniques for lifting and moving, and operation of equipment.
  • Document and elevate any concerns through the appropriate avenues for maintenance or execution concerns.
  • Ensure equipment is set up or stored orderly and securely in assigned locations.
  • Routine minor maintenance and care for assigned equipment, such as vacuuming carpeted stage before breakdown, polishing dance floor tiles, annual chair cleaning and detailing, and more.
  • Understand overall event and theatre schedules and proactively anticipate and troubleshoot storage issues.
  • Write and send a post-shift report detailing status of assigned tasks, concerns or maintenance issues, equipment condition updates, and highlights regarding personnel performance.
  • Afford assistance with administrative and operational duties or special projects of the Venue Operations department as assigned.

Supervisor Responsibility

Oversees conversion crew team members during assigned shift (no direct reports).

Work Environment

  • Primarily performed in a 166,000 square foot building including spaces in theatres, lobbies, a large ballroom, reception room, loading docks, and storage spaces.
  • Shifts are scheduled based on the needs of the event and are usually scheduled for 4-6 hours at varying times of day and night.
  • Requires working with and around groups of various people with differing functions and roles.
  • Physical requirements include vigorous movement within the work environment, lifting and moving items up to 50 pounds (or team lift up to 80 pounds), using hands to handle or feel, bending, walking, reaching, climbing ladders, and utilizing a lift.
  • May need to work in aerial lifts or on loft storage spaces at heights up to 25 feet.
